Authorizes the village of Trumansburg to offer a twenty-year retirement plan to police officer Mackenzie M. Covert.
This bill authorizes the village of Trumansburg to offer an optional twenty-year retirement plan to Mackenzie M. Covert, a police officer who was appointed with the Trumansburg Police Department. The village can elect to assume the additional cost of this plan by filing a resolution with the state comptroller within one year of the bill's effective date. Mackenzie M. Covert will be entitled to full rights and benefits under the twenty-year retirement plan if she elects to participate. The village will bear all past service costs associated with this plan.
